濟南的軟件開發公司提供濟南市本地話軟件開發,濟南APP開發,山東全省軟件開發服務,APP開發,四色預警系統,電子地圖WEBGIS開發,濟南手機軟件開發,濟南手機軟件開發,濟南app定制軟件開發,濟南數據庫軟件開發

濟南軟件開發公司-濟南萬網互聯科技有限公司提供軟件開發,app開發,手機開發,軟件定制開發服務 濟南軟件開發,濟南APP開發,山東軟件開發,濟南軟件公司
  首頁 軟件開發 APP開發 WEBIG開發 四色預警 軟件定制開發 軟件開發外包 案例展示 新聞中心 聯系我們
軟件產品
治安動態四色預警研判系統
線路資源圖形管理系統
WebGIS城市地下管線管理系統
   
 
成功案例
泰安泰山區公安局四色預預警系統
泰安網通線路資源圖形管理系統
濟南市鹽務局信息化系統
山東省農業機械辦公室信息提報系統
山東省港航局沿海港口管理系統
 
 
濟南軟件開發公司 > 軟件開發知識
  
 

標準軟件開發過程六個階段

文章作者:admin    發布時間:2018-02-05

  軟件開發方案是在軟件開發的前期,甲乙雙方根據軟件開發的標準流程制定軟件開發方案。
 
  方案介紹
 
  軟件開發的標準過程包括六個階段,而六個階段需要編寫的各類文件達14種之多,在每個階段需要編寫哪些文件,根據軟件開發的標準流程制定軟件開發方案:
 
  1.可行性與計劃研究階段
 
  可行性研究報告:在可行性研究與計劃階段內,要確定該軟件的開發目標和總的要求,要進行可行性分析、投資一收益分析、制訂開發計劃,并完成應編制的文件。
 
  項目開發計劃:編制項目開發計劃的目的是用文件的形式,把對于在開發過程中各項工作的負責人員、開發進度、所需經費預算、所需軟、硬件條件等問題作出的安排記載下來,以便根據本計劃開展和檢查本項目的開發工作。
 
  2.需求分析階段
 
  軟件需求說明書:軟件需求說明書的編制是為了使用戶和軟件開發者雙方對該軟件的初始規定有一個共同的理解,使之成為整個開發工作的基礎。內容包括對功能的規定對性能的規定等。
 
  數據要求說明書:數據要求說明書的編制目的是為了向整個開發時期提供關于被處理數據的描述和數據采集要求的技術信息。
 
  初步的用戶手冊:用戶手冊的編制是要使用非專門術語的語言,充分地描述該軟件系統所具有的功能及基本的使用方法。使用戶(或潛在用戶)通過本手冊能夠了解該軟件的用途,并且能夠確定在什么情況下,如何使用它。
 
  3.設計階段
 
  概要設計說明書:概要設計說明書又可稱系統設計說明書,這里所說的系統是指程序系統。編制的目的是說明對程序系統的設計考慮,包括程序系統的基本處理流程、程序系統的組織結構、模塊劃分、功能分配、接口設計。運行設計、數據結構設計和出錯處理設計等,為程序的詳細設計提供基礎。
 
  詳細設計說明書:詳細設計說明書又可稱程序設計說明書。編制目的是說明一個軟件系統各個層次中的每一個程序(每個模塊或子程序)的設計考慮,如果一個軟件系統比較簡單,層次很少,本文件可以不單獨編寫,有關內容合并入概要設計說明書。
 
  數據庫設計說明書:數據庫設計說明書的編制目的是對于設計中的數據庫的所有標識、邏輯結構和物理結構作出具體的設計規定。
 
  測試計劃初稿:這里所說的測試,主要是指整個程序系統的組裝測試和確認測試。本文件的編制是為了提供一個對該軟件的測試計劃,包括對每項測試活動的內容、進度安排、設計考慮、測試數據的整理方法及評價準則。
 
  4.實現階段
 
  模塊開發卷宗(開始編寫):模塊開發卷宗是在模塊開發過程中逐步編寫出來的,每完成一個模塊或一組密切相關的模塊的復審時編寫一份,應該把所有的模塊開發卷宗匯集在一起。編寫的目的是記錄和匯總低層次開發的進度和結果,以便于對整個模塊開發工作的管理和復審,并為將來的維護提供非常有用的技術信息。
 
  用戶手冊完工
 
  操作手冊:操作手冊的編制是為了向操作人員提供該軟件每一個運行的具體過程和有關知識,包括操作方法的細節。
 
  測試計劃終稿
 
  5.測試階段
 
  模塊開發卷宗(此階段內必須完成)
 
  測試分析報告:測試分析報告的編寫是為了把組裝測試和確認測試的結果、發現及分析寫成文件加以記載。
 
  項目開發總結報告:項目開發總結報告的編制是為了總結本項目開發工作的經驗,說明實際取得的開發結果以及對整個開發工作的各個方面的評價。
 
  6.運行與維護階段
 
  開發進度月報的編制目的是及時向有關管理部門匯報項目開發的進展和情況,以便及時發現和處理開發過程中出現的問題。一般地,開發進度月報是以項目組為單位每月編寫的。如果被開發的軟件系統規模比較大,整個工程項目被劃分給若干個分項目組承擔,開發進度月報將以分項目組為單位按月編寫。
 
  對于一項軟件而言,有些文件的編寫工作可能要在若干個階段中延續進行。
 
  鑒于軟件開發是具有創造性的腦力勞動,也鑒于不同軟件在規模上和復雜程度上差別極大,本指南認為在文件編制工作中應允許一定的靈活性,并不是14種文件每種都必須編寫。
 
以上資料由本站濟南軟件開發系統管理員搜集整理提供,歡迎訪問濟南軟件開發公司官網(http://www.skevjp.icu)。
 

 此文關鍵字:標準軟件開發過程六個階段
 原創文章來源:/soft/37.html 轉載請注明出處!
 上一篇:開發軟件的幾種方法下一篇:軟件項目開發計劃書的作用

公司地址:濟南市天橋區北關北路青年創業園  
版權所有:濟南萬網互聯科技有限公司 魯ICP備10008901號

幸运飞艇计划软件安卓版